Loving the new Queensbridge road cycle lanes in Hackney. Bravo @jonburkeUK @hackneycouncil & @hackney_cycling for campaigning for them.
Combined with modal filters, tiger crossings and continuous pavement too. Shows perfectly who's prioritised first.
The rest of my journey home was uneventful on CS1 (sorry no pics), before stress free crossing of London Bridge, followed by the lovely new Cycleway 4 (pictured here on Tooley Street). Nice and wide allowing people to overtake those on cargo bikes without issue.
Even the good bit of Quietway 1 (Edward Street) felt relaxing. Unfortunately same can't be said for Deptford Church street and Lewisham Town centre.
The last bit of the journey involved the A21 (Molesworth street) which is far from perfect southbound, and then followed by 2 close passes on Leahurst road and Manor Lane in the watered down #LeeGreenLTN .
Thankfully got to the top of Burnt Ash Hill with 2km range left on the battery.
Whoever thinks e-bikes are cheating, try riding 50kg of Bakfiets around London for a day. Those @pedalmeapp riders must have legs of steel!
